Synopsis:
It is one of the most famous detective stories ever written, and also considered to be one of Sir Arthur Conan Doyle's (1859-1930) best works. In the story, the old and noble Baskerville family is threatened by a curse: "A great, black beast, shaped like a hound, yet larger than any hound that ever mortal eye has rested upon" terrorises and kills any family member who comes to live at the Baskerville estate. Once again, it is Sherlock Holmes who, together with his friend Dr Watson, solves the mystery of the creepy and cold marshland around Baskerville hall.
